My vtech vreader won't read the sd card. Tried everything posted on this site and more. Please help!
Hey there, seems like you've already tried many solutions.
May I suggest checking if the SD card has been formatted before its first use (check to see if your SD card is formatted as a FAT16 or FAT32 partition). I have attached a link with further details on doing this.
Also make sure your SD card is not in write-protected mode (the Lock switch on your SD card should be in the off position) and try again.
As well, make sure you have the most updated software on your device.
